
SAP作为企业资源规划(ERP)系统的佼佼者,广泛应用于各行各业,实现了企业资源的集中管理和流程优化
而MySQL,作为一款开源的关系型数据库管理系统,以其高性能、灵活性和易用性,在数据处理和存储方面展现出了强大的优势
将SAP中的数据导入MySQL,不仅能够实现数据的多样化存储与分析,还能进一步促进业务智能化,为企业带来前所未有的竞争优势
本文将深入探讨MySQL导入SAP的必要性、实施步骤、面临的挑战及解决方案,以期为企业提供一套切实可行的数据整合方案
一、MySQL导入SAP的必要性 1. 数据灵活性与可扩展性 SAP系统虽然功能强大,但在数据处理和存储的灵活性上相对有限
随着企业业务的不断扩展,数据量急剧增加,对存储和查询效率提出了更高要求
MySQL以其开源特性、丰富的插件生态以及良好的扩展性,能够满足大规模数据处理的需求,为SAP数据提供额外的存储和访问通道
2.数据分析与报告 SAP擅长的是业务操作和管理,但在复杂的数据分析和高级报告生成方面,可能需要额外的工具或模块支持
MySQL与众多数据分析工具(如Tableau、Power BI等)的无缝集成,使得企业能够轻松构建定制化的数据分析模型,深入挖掘数据价值,为管理层提供更为精准的决策支持
3. 成本效益 相较于SAP自带的高端数据库解决方案,MySQL的开源特性大大降低了企业的IT成本
尤其是在数据仓库构建、历史数据存档等场景中,采用MySQL作为辅助存储,可以显著减少长期运营成本,同时保持数据的高可用性和安全性
二、MySQL导入SAP的实施步骤 1.需求分析与规划 在实施数据迁移前,首先要明确迁移的目的、范围、时间表以及预期成果
这包括确定哪些SAP数据需要迁移、迁移后的数据存储结构、访问权限设置等
合理的规划是成功迁移的基础
2. 数据模型设计 根据SAP中的数据结构和业务需求,在MySQL中设计相应的数据表结构
这包括定义字段类型、主键、外键约束等,确保数据的一致性和完整性
同时,考虑到性能优化,可能需要设计索引、分区等策略
3. 数据提取与转换 利用ETL(Extract, Transform, Load)工具,如Talend、Informatica等,从SAP系统中提取数据,并根据MySQL的数据模型进行必要的转换和清洗
这一步骤是迁移过程中的关键,直接关系到数据的质量和后续分析的有效性
4. 数据加载与验证 将转换后的数据加载到MySQL数据库中,并进行严格的数据验证,确保数据的准确性、完整性和一致性
这包括记录数比对、关键字段值校验等
5. 系统集成与测试 完成数据迁移后,需将MySQL数据库与现有业务系统集成,确保数据的实时同步和访问
同时,进行全面的系统测试,包括功能测试、性能测试、安全测试等,确保迁移后的系统稳定运行
三、面临的挑战及解决方案 1. 数据一致性问题 在数据迁移过程中,保持数据的一致性是一大挑战
解决方案包括采用事务处理机制确保数据提取与加载的原子性,以及在迁移前后进行数据快照比对,及时发现并修复数据不一致问题
2. 性能瓶颈 大规模数据迁移和处理可能会遇到性能瓶颈
优化策略包括分批迁移、使用高效的数据传输协议、对MySQL进行性能调优(如调整内存配置、优化查询语句等)
3. 安全与合规 数据迁移过程中需严格遵守数据保护法规,确保数据的安全传输和存储
解决方案包括使用加密技术保护数据传输安全,实施严格的访问控制策略,以及定期进行安全审计和漏洞扫描
4. 业务中断风险 迁移过程中可能会对现有业务造成一定影响
因此,制定详细的迁移计划和应急预案至关重要,包括设置回滚机制、在业务低峰期进行迁移操作、提前通知相关用户等
四、案例分享与效果评估 许多企业已成功实施了MySQL导入SAP的项目,实现了数据的高效整合与分析
例如,某制造业企业通过此方案,将SAP中的生产数据、库存数据等导入MySQL,结合大数据分析工具,实现了生产效率的显著提升和库存成本的有效降低
此外,通过构建实时数据仓库,企业能够更快地响应市场变化,做出更加精准的决策
效果评估方面,可以从数据迁移的成功率、数据质量、系统性能提升、业务效率改善、成本节约等多个维度进行综合考量
定期回顾迁移项目的成效,及时调整优化策略,确保数据整合的持续有效性
五、结语 MySQL导入SAP,作为数据整合与业务智能化的一种重要途径,正逐渐成为众多企业的选择
通过科学规划、精细实施和持续优化,企业不仅能够克服迁移过程中的各种挑战,还能充分利用MySQL的灵活性和高性能,为SAP数据赋能,驱动业务向更高层次发展
在这个数据为王的时代,把握住数据整合的先机,就是把握住了企业未来发展的主动权
亿级数据挑战:高效管理MySQL策略
MySQL高效导入SAP数据全攻略
MySQL首装:默认密码查询指南
MySQL设置ID自增技巧
揭秘MySQL的data目录结构与作用
深入理解MySQL:硬解析与软解析的性能奥秘
Win7系统下MySQL my.cnf配置指南
亿级数据挑战:高效管理MySQL策略
MySQL首装:默认密码查询指南
MySQL设置ID自增技巧
揭秘MySQL的data目录结构与作用
深入理解MySQL:硬解析与软解析的性能奥秘
Win7系统下MySQL my.cnf配置指南
MySQL索引优化:设置顺序技巧
MySQL事务重启操作指南
C语言如何连接MySQL数据库
MySQL操作:一键减少所有分数
MySQL技巧:如何实现INSERT操作时变量值+1
MySQL实体视图:数据可视化的秘密武器